George Herrick 1825–1900 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 26 Nov 1825
Birth Location: Middlefield, Hampshire, Massachusetts, USA
Death Date: 15 May 1900
Death Location: Painesville, Ohio, USA
Father: Avery Herrick
Mother: Mary Chapin
Spouse(s): Ann Magoon
Children(s): Louis Herrick, George Herrick, Florence Hewick, Frances Herrick
George Herrick was born in 1825 in Middlefield, Hampshire, Massachusetts, USA, the child of Avery Herrick And Mary Polly Chapin. In 1863, George Herrick resided in 5th Ward, Wisconsin, USA. George Herrick married Ann Eliza Magoon, and had children including Florence M Hewick, Frances Mary Herrick, George Dwight Herrick, Louis Chapin Herrick. George Herrick passed away in 1900 in Painesville, Ohio, USA.
